Season-by-Season Pitching
← Scroll for more →
Year Team W L ERA G GS SV IP H ER BB SO WHIP
1925 NLG 1 4 5.43 9 7 0 53.0 62 32 28 28 1.70
1925 WMP 1 2 4.50 5 4 0 28.0 37 14 7 4 1.57
1926 NLG 8 9 5.25 22 13 0 152.2 158 89 76 88 1.53
1927 NLG 1 5 7.14 8 5 0 40.1 48 32 27 29 1.86
Career Totals 11 20 5.49 44 29 0 274.0 305 167 138 149 1.62
